Scenario:
Bard (level 10) casts Charm Monster on big dumb monster - say an Ogre.
Ogre fails save miserably and is now the bard's bestest friend - for the next ten days.
Day 8: Bard casts Charm Monster on his good buddy the ogre, encouraging him to accept the helpful magic! Ogre intentionally fails save.
Day 10: Original Charm effect is over.
Question: Does the second Charm effect remain?
The SRD doesn't really talk about the longer durations of spells, merely that sometimes one effect can supersede another. Any thoughts, preferably with a rule behind them, of what happens on day ten?
